Off-season tip # 1: Do not train like a crazy

It is likely that as the training that is a crazy season and your body needs an active rest. If you were training at all its potential will be very difficult for your body to maintain very intense and long training courses every year.

Now is the time to give body and mind a rest taking it easy and try something different. Maybe spending time with family or call some friends and relatives who have not spoken with in the last eight months of training. It would probably be very happy to hear from you.

Off-season tip # 2: Cross-Train

If all they do is swim, biking and running, will have serious deficiencies in developing muscles not used during these activities. This can affect performance and cause injuries. Take this off-season to do other things you enjoy muscles activate forgotten.

Go surfing, hiking, skiing, or playing a football, soccer, hockey, Definitely so, swim, bike and run occasionally, but keep the intensity below the maximum and maintaining unstructured. Just go by feel, and if you is the type who feels the need to punish yourself each workout, maybe you need to structure off-season workouts to be less intense.

Off-season tip # 3: go to the gym

I can talk until I was blue in the face about the benefits of strength training for athletes resistance, but many still refuse to do so, especially due to time constraints. Now is the season, practices are shorter, and it's time to hit weights.

Strength training and resistance is probably the best thing you can do to increase power and prevent injuries. Just start slow if you are new to the resistance training, then increasing sets, reps, weight, duration of rest, etc. on the fly. It would be better to find a training or get a personal trainer, but only makes it better than none at all. Just make sure you are using the proper technique or you could hurt yourself.

Start slow and work your way up. Do not you feel the need to throw around heavy weights and bars to train for more power. Resistance bands, balls stability, medicine balls, and many body weight exercises can be as beneficial and far less dangerous. All you need is two to three days a week for 20 to 30 minutes. Try to make circuits with back-to-back movements without rest.

Off-season tip # 4: Concentrate on a

Now is the time to correct the problems he has with his technique. You workouts should be shorter and less intense, so now you can really focus on correcting defect in his career swimming, cycling efficiency or running form.

What is the use of countless hours of poor record on form? His body only learn the bad technique and it will be harder to correct later. Use this offseason to improve their technical weaknesses, allowing you to go faster and consume less energy. Check out his technical coach and maybe even get some video of yourself so you can see what are doing wrong.

Off-season tip # 5: Plan your race calendar

What is the next best thing careers and training? The career planning and training, of course!

Do some research on the careers that you might want to do next year. You can start planning their initial training to be prepared for careers based on distance and terrain of the race. Can not decide which to try his first Ironman a month out of the race, which may not be ready in time.
